Soft biometric qualities allude to physical and conduct attributes, for example, orientation, stature and weight, which are not extraordinary to a particular subject, but rather are valuable for ID, confirmation, and portrayal of human subjects. Soft biometric properties can be joined with old style biometric qualities to work on the exactness of a biometric acknowledgment framework. They can likewise be utilized as channels to confine the pursuit during a biometric ID activity. The extraction of soft biometric traits can likewise be valuable in other application areas, like medical services, human PC communication (HCI), advanced mechanics, and gaming.
